Adelaide, Dec. 19 -- Australian batter Alex Carey became just the fourth wicketkeeper-batter and third Aussie keeper-batter to get a fifty-plus score in both innings of an Ashes Test.
Carey achieved this milestone during his side's third Ashes Test against England at Adelaide Oval on Friday. After a brilliant 106 in 143 balls, consisting of eight boundaries and a six and which was his first Ashes ton, Carey followed it with a 52* in 91 balls, with four boundaries to end the day three. With two more days to go and Aussies looking to outbat England out of the contest, a pair of centuries would not be a far-fetched idea.
